News: One dies from solo-vehicle crash in Austin
AUSTIN, TX – A solo-vehicle crash killed one person on Monday morning, July 18, FOX 7 reported.
The collision happened near FM 969, and Decker Lane around 2:26 am. Police believe speeding could have been a factor in Monday’s crash, but they are still investigating all the details.
The person, whose name was not released, was transported to a hospital, where they died.
